I got WS7II and MAX M8. I think 421B more or less similar to MAX M8. My buddy runs V-Spec. V-spec linearly puts down power so for smooth driving. M8 gives fair deal at bottom end but becomes a screamer at top end upon a 100m straight for 3 sec orgasm. WS7II is a screamer all the way through.
